回答:每個(gè)平臺(tái)有自己的實(shí)現(xiàn)而已,大體意思都一編程先要了解邏輯和思想,至于api 那只是每個(gè)平臺(tái)為了實(shí)現(xiàn)功能提供的接口而已。比如網(wǎng)絡(luò)編程,你要知道什么是阻塞,非阻塞,同步,異步的概念,了解了這些以后,再去關(guān)注你想學(xué)習(xí)的系統(tǒng),比如linux下的非阻塞模型,select,poll,epoll比如windows下的select,iocp再比如多線程,你要了解什么是多線程,什么是鎖,什么是線程同步,知道可這些以...
問(wèn)題描述:關(guān)于服務(wù)器問(wèn)題是服務(wù)器c段什么意思這個(gè)問(wèn)題,大家能幫我解決一下嗎?
回答:編譯器用gcc或者 clang,項(xiàng)目用makefile或者cmake,調(diào)試用gdb,ide可以用qtcreator,eclipse,文本編輯可以用vim和emacs。vim用熟了,效率確實(shí)高,代碼跟進(jìn)和調(diào)試都很快。emacs沒(méi)怎么用過(guò),國(guó)外用的比較多,我在window上編譯linux程序比較多,linux上開(kāi)共享,直接在windows上用vs,ue或者sublime編輯代碼和makefile再用x...
...L地址 瀏覽器解析URL解析出主機(jī)名 瀏覽器將主機(jī)名轉(zhuǎn)換成服務(wù)器ip地址(瀏覽器先查找本地DNS緩存列表 沒(méi)有的話 再向?yàn)g覽器默認(rèn)的DNS服務(wù)器發(fā)送查詢請(qǐng)求 同時(shí)緩存) 瀏覽器將端口號(hào)從URL中解析出來(lái) 瀏覽器建立一條與目標(biāo)Web服...
...,我們可以設(shè)置window.location.href = url來(lái)進(jìn)行跳轉(zhuǎn)。但是在服務(wù)器環(huán)境中,并沒(méi)有window和document這2個(gè)對(duì)象,所以我們?cè)诜?wù)器環(huán)境中拋出一個(gè)異常,然后捕獲到之后進(jìn)行302跳轉(zhuǎn)。具體可以看src/helpers/location.js, 中的redirect function他會(huì)...
...ingle Page Application) 出現(xiàn)之前,網(wǎng)頁(yè)就是在服務(wù)端渲染的。服務(wù)器接收到客戶端請(qǐng)求后,將數(shù)據(jù)和模板拼接成完整的頁(yè)面響應(yīng)到客戶端。 客戶端直接渲染, 此時(shí)用戶希望瀏覽新的頁(yè)面,就必須重復(fù)這個(gè)過(guò)程, 刷新頁(yè)面. 這種體驗(yàn)...
...用雪碧圖(CSS SPRITE); 緩存。 使用緩存可以減少向服務(wù)器的請(qǐng)求數(shù),節(jié)省加載時(shí)間,所以所有靜態(tài)資源都要在服務(wù)器端設(shè)置緩存,并且盡量使用長(zhǎng)Cache(長(zhǎng)Cache資源的更新可使用時(shí)間戳)。 a) 緩存一切可緩存的資源;b) 使用...
...美,比如像下面的例子: // ......省略 但是到了服務(wù)器渲染中,你想這么干是鐵定行不通了,因?yàn)樵诜?wù)端壓根就不會(huì)執(zhí)行到mounted的生命周期中,我們之前說(shuō)過(guò)在服務(wù)器端Vue的實(shí)例僅僅只會(huì)執(zhí)行生命周期函數(shù)beforeCreate和c...
...】VNode - 源碼版 今天就來(lái)探索 VNode 的源碼,VNode 是 Vue2 渲染機(jī)制中很重要的一部分,是深入Vue 必須了解的部分 我們以4個(gè)問(wèn)題來(lái)開(kāi)始我們的探索 1、vnode 是什么及其作用 2、vnode 什么時(shí)候生成 3、vnode 怎么生成 4、vnode 存放什...
React渲染過(guò)程 我們都知道使用React可以使得網(wǎng)頁(yè)的性能有很大的提高,本文具體探究它是通過(guò)什么樣的渲染機(jī)制做到的。 在頁(yè)面一開(kāi)始打開(kāi)的時(shí)候,React會(huì)調(diào)用render函數(shù)構(gòu)建一棵Dom樹(shù),在state/props發(fā)生改變的時(shí)候,render函數(shù)會(huì)...
...并用于 Google 的瀏覽器 Chrome。 Node.js(Node):一個(gè)用于在服務(wù)器運(yùn)行 JavaScript 的運(yùn)行時(shí)(runtime),它擁有文件系統(tǒng)和網(wǎng)絡(luò)的權(quán)限(你的電腦也可以是一臺(tái)服務(wù)器?。?。 開(kāi)發(fā)體驗(yàn)如何? 基于 Electron 的開(kāi)發(fā),就好像開(kāi)發(fā)一個(gè)網(wǎng)頁(yè)...
細(xì)說(shuō) Vue 組件的服務(wù)器端渲染 聲明:需要讀者對(duì) NodeJs、Vue 服務(wù)器端渲染有一定的了解 現(xiàn)在,前后端分離與客戶端渲染已經(jīng)成為前端開(kāi)發(fā)的主流模式,絕大部分的前端應(yīng)用都適合用這種方式來(lái)開(kāi)發(fā),又特別是 React、Vue 等組件...
...求都會(huì)產(chǎn)生一次渲染嗎?渲染總是要計(jì)算的,這樣多浪費(fèi)服務(wù)器性能?。〈_實(shí)是這樣,除非你用了緩存。 頁(yè)面緩存的方案 1. 純靜態(tài)頁(yè)面 直接放 CDN。純靜態(tài)頁(yè)面的訪問(wèn)量一般不會(huì)很大,程序直接響應(yīng)也是可以的。 2. 純動(dòng)態(tài)頁(yè)面 ...
...求都會(huì)產(chǎn)生一次渲染嗎?渲染總是要計(jì)算的,這樣多浪費(fèi)服務(wù)器性能??!確實(shí)是這樣,除非你用了緩存。 頁(yè)面緩存的方案 1. 純靜態(tài)頁(yè)面 直接放 CDN。純靜態(tài)頁(yè)面的訪問(wèn)量一般不會(huì)很大,程序直接響應(yīng)也是可以的。 2. 純動(dòng)態(tài)頁(yè)面 ...
...代碼繁瑣,改一個(gè)問(wèn)題的時(shí)候可能需要修改兩次 增大了服務(wù)器中的文件體積 2.改進(jìn)后利用jq同一動(dòng)態(tài)渲染;(這邊主要是通過(guò)將需要渲染文字的元素定義好id,再定義好id與文字的映射關(guān)系,最后通過(guò)jq的選擇器進(jìn)行統(tǒng)一渲染) a.htm...
...3)執(zhí)行流程: 方法一: 發(fā)起組件1的請(qǐng)求 -> 組件1數(shù)據(jù)到達(dá)后渲染組件1 -> 發(fā)起組件2的請(qǐng)求 -> 組件2數(shù)據(jù)到達(dá)后渲染組件2 -> 發(fā)起組件3的請(qǐng)求 -> 組件3數(shù)據(jù)到達(dá)后渲染組件3 方法二: 同時(shí)發(fā)起組件1,2,3的請(qǐng)求 -> 組件1,2,3的數(shù)據(jù)都到達(dá)后...
...3)執(zhí)行流程: 方法一: 發(fā)起組件1的請(qǐng)求 -> 組件1數(shù)據(jù)到達(dá)后渲染組件1 -> 發(fā)起組件2的請(qǐng)求 -> 組件2數(shù)據(jù)到達(dá)后渲染組件2 -> 發(fā)起組件3的請(qǐng)求 -> 組件3數(shù)據(jù)到達(dá)后渲染組件3 方法二: 同時(shí)發(fā)起組件1,2,3的請(qǐng)求 -> 組件1,2,3的數(shù)據(jù)都到達(dá)后...
ChatGPT和Sora等AI大模型應(yīng)用,將AI大模型和算力需求的熱度不斷帶上新的臺(tái)階。哪里可以獲得...
營(yíng)銷(xiāo)賬號(hào)總被封?TK直播頻繁掉線?雙ISP靜態(tài)住宅IP+輕量云主機(jī)打包套餐來(lái)襲,確保開(kāi)出來(lái)的云主機(jī)不...
大模型的訓(xùn)練用4090是不合適的,但推理(inference/serving)用4090不能說(shuō)合適,...